Summary
Steroid 5α-reductase activity is demonstrated in the adrenal cortex of male and female rats (F > M). Following either orchiectomy or ovariectomy, activity of the enzyme is elevated extending previous findings of increased adrenal 5a-metabolite formation in gonadectomized rats. Reductase activity in adrenal tissue from castrate males is greater than that from castrate females. NADH enhances enzyme activity in whole homogenates. Centrifugation studies demonstrate most of the activity to reside in the 105,000g sediment. Compared to corticosterone, testosterone is a more preferred substrate, whereas Cortisol is less well metabolized and aldosterone least of all.
